Whatsapp To Help Users Auto Block Messages From Unknown Numbers

WhatsApp introduced the feature (dubbed “Block unknown account messages”) in an earlier Android beta release (2.24.17.14). However, all beta testers can now access and use the feature in the latest beta version (2.24.20.16). The screenshot above says WhatsApp will only block messages from unknown accounts “if they exceed a certain volume.” That means the feature won’t block all messages from unknown senders. Instead, WhatsApp blocks messages from unknown numbers that usually send excessive messages within a short period....

How To Cancel Your Espn Subscription

Below, we’ll explain exactly how you can cancel an ESPN subscription. How to Cancel Your ESPN Subscription The easiest way to cancel your ESPN Plus subscription is via the ESPN website: Note: ESPN+ doesn’t provide refunds for partially used billing cycles. If you cancel halfway through a billing period, you’ll still have access to the ESPN+ subscription until the end of that period. How to Cancel ESPN Plus on an Android If you use an Android device, you can also cancel ESPN+ through the Google Play Store app....
